Understanding Facebook’s Advertising Policies and Updates

Understanding Facebook’s advertising policies and staying informed about updates is essential for maintaining effective ad campaigns. Facebook frequently revises its policies to enhance user experience and ensure compliance with various regulations. Marketers must take the time to review these changes, as failure to adhere can result in penalties such as ad disapproval or even account suspension. Visiting the Facebook Business Help Center regularly can help marketers stay abreast of any amendments made to advertising policies, thus ensuring ongoing compliance and optimizing ad performance.

In addition to checking the Facebook Business Help Center, marketers can subscribe to official Facebook communications or follow dedicated Facebook marketing blogs for real-time updates. Engaging in community forums, such as Facebook Groups for marketers, can also provide insights and tips shared by other professionals facing similar challenges. By proactively adopting these strategies, marketers can maintain compliance with evolving advertising standards and leverage the latest features provided by Facebook to enhance their campaigns.

How Facebook’s Algorithm Affects Your Marketing Strategy

Understanding how Facebook’s algorithm functions is crucial for shaping your marketing strategy. The algorithm determines which ads are shown to which users, heavily influencing engagement and interaction levels. Recognizing that this system analyzes user behavior, interests, and demographics helps businesses tailor their campaigns effectively. For instance, creating high-quality, engaging content that resonates with your target audience can improve your chances of being showcased in more news feeds.

The algorithm rewards posts that foster interaction, meaning likes, shares, and comments play a significant role in visibility. Businesses can leverage this by engaging their audience right after posting, encouraging discussions, and responding promptly to comments. Additionally, using data analytics and monitoring ad performance allows for strategic adjustments that can enhance reach and effectiveness. Ultimately, aligning your marketing objectives with the algorithm’s preferences can lead to improved campaign outcomes.

Strategies for Effective Ad Campaign Optimization

Optimizing Facebook advertising campaigns requires a strategic approach that goes beyond just creating ads. It’s essential to understand key performance indicators such as click-through rate (CTR), cost per click (CPC), and conversion rate. These metrics help determine how effectively your ads are driving traffic and generating sales. By analyzing this data, marketers can refine their targeting and messaging, ensuring that they reach the most relevant audience for their products or services.

Using Facebook’s Ads Manager efficiently can greatly enhance your advertising optimization efforts. Begin by defining clear campaign objectives, whether that be brand awareness, lead generation, or sales conversions. By strategically selecting your audience and crafting compelling ad content, you can make informed decisions based on performance metrics. A clear understanding of your audience’s demographics and interests will not only improve engagement but will also help in optimizing your ad spend.

Regularly reviewing and adjusting your ad campaigns is vital for achieving optimal results. This involves A/B testing different creatives, refining your audience parameters, and even experimenting with various ad placements. Facebook provides robust reporting tools that allow you to gauge performance in real-time, enabling quick pivots as needed. Staying informed about platform updates and algorithm changes will also ensure that your campaigns remain compliant with Facebook’s advertising policies, leading to sustained success.

Resources for Following Facebook Advertising Policy Changes

Staying informed about Facebook’s advertising policies is crucial for maintaining compliance and optimizing your advertising efforts. The first and most direct resource is Facebook’s Business Help Center, where you can find updated guidelines and specific details about ad formats, targeting, and creative requirements. Regularly checking this resource allows marketers to understand the policies thoroughly and adjust campaigns as needed to avoid unnecessary disruptions or ad rejections.

In addition to the formal guidelines, joining industry groups or forums focused on Facebook advertising can be highly beneficial. These communities often share real-time experiences about changes in policies and how they affect advertising strategies. Engaging with fellow professionals provides insights that go beyond the text of the policies, giving you practical advice and tips on how to navigate complex advertising situations effectively.

Lastly, consider following Facebook’s official business accounts on social media platforms. These accounts share updates about changes, highlight new features, and often provide case studies about successful advertising campaigns. By actively engaging with these accounts, marketers can stay informed about the latest best practices, ensuring that their advertising strategies align with both current policies and effective marketing trends.
